davidmonterocrespo24 93fd4617af feat(sim): boot_images module + Pi 3 emulation restored
Pi 3 simulation had been broken since at least April 2026 (51
fail-events / 24h per docs/PI3_EMULATION_BROKEN.md). Two distinct
defects compounded:

1. qemu_manager.py hard-coded paths for kernel8.img, a device-tree
   blob (under a DOS 8.3 short name!), and a 5.4 GiB Raspberry Pi OS
   SD image — none of which shipped in the repo or were pulled at
   image build.

2. qemu-system-arm + qemu-utils were missing from the Docker image
   entirely, so even with the boot files in place QEMU couldn't
   launch. Add both to Dockerfile.standalone (~200 MB).

The architecture fix is a new `app.services.boot_images` module:

  * Manifest-driven (boot_images/manifest.json, versioned in repo,
    declares SHA256 + size for each file, supports an optional
    `compressed.{encoding,sha256,size_bytes}` block for assets shipped
    as .zst).

  * `BootImageProvider` materialises files lazily, atomically (temp +
    rename), verifies SHA256 pre- AND post-decompression, caches under
    /var/cache/velxio/boot-images, serialises concurrent get() calls
    per image set via asyncio.Lock.

  * `AssetDownloader` Protocol with two impls:
    - `LicenseGatedDownloader` — same flow ESP32 / RISC-V QEMU libs
      use (VELXIO_BINARY_BASE_URL + VELXIO_LICENSE_KEY).
    - `LocalDirectoryDownloader` — for tests + in-prod use where the
      licence-module storage is already on the same filesystem (saves
      the loopback HTTP roundtrip on a 1.4 GiB blob).

  * `build_downloader_from_env()` picks one — local-dir wins if both
    sets of env vars are present, so the prod box short-circuits to
    direct disk reads automatically.

  * Lifespan hook in qemu_manager.py pre-warms the cache on container
    boot so first-time user requests don't pay the 30-60 s download
    + decompress latency.

Adding a future board kind (Pi 4 / Pi 5) is now: upload assets via
upload-binary.sh, append an entry to manifest.json, register a
lifespan pre-warm in the new board's service module. Zero edits to
provider.py / downloader.py.

Manifest entries for raspberry-pi-3:
  kernel8.img             9 695 883 bytes  (uncompressed)
  bcm2710-rpi-3-b.dtb        34 687 bytes  (uncompressed)
  raspios-trixie-armhf.img  5 729 419 264 bytes raw
                          / 1 488 002 803 bytes .zst on wire (zstd -19)
  source: 2026-04-21 build from raspberrypi.com

Tests: 21 new unit tests covering manifest parsing, integrity
helpers, both downloaders, and the provider's idempotent /
concurrent / integrity / decompression / warmup paths. In-process
FakeDownloader keeps the suite under 1 s and httpx-free.

Docs: new docs/BOOT_IMAGES.md describes the architecture, on-disk
layout, named-volume operation, and the procedure for adding a new
image set.
